The whole world of football is waiting for the consequences of suspending the match between Brazil and Argentina for the Qatar 2022 Qualifiers. Several questions remain on the table hours after sanitary agents of the South American giant entered the Arena Do Corinthians to stop a shock that already had a few minutes of history. FIFA has returned to express itself with a statement that makes it clear that there is much still to be known.

Let us remember that since it is a competition for an event of the highest entity in world football, it will be FIFA and not Conmebol who will make the decisions around a classic that is hard to think that it can be played in the short term. The Playoffs schedule is tighter than ever and the World Cup will take place in just 14 months.

"FIFA regrets the scenes that preceded the suspension of the match between Brazil and Argentina for the 2022 FIFA World Cup CONMEBOL qualifiers, which prevented millions of fans from enjoying a match between two of the most important nations. of the world, "began the statement issued from Zurich minutes ago.

Everything indicates that there will be no decisions throughout the day, so the consequences of the suspension will not be published for a couple of days: “The first official match reports have been sent to FIFA. This information will be analyzed by the competent disciplinary bodies and a decision will be made in due course".

The qualifying round is halfway there and although there is a general desire to see a new face-to-face between Messi and Neymar, the participation of FIFA's disciplinary bodies suggests that the final result of the match between Brazil and Argentina will be defined from Zurich.
